A handicap certificate is a certificate from your golf club, stating your official handicap.

Lots of courses over here say you need one to play, but most courses don't actually ask to see it. It is usually there, so if you are really bad and tearing up the course a ranger can kick you off and cite your handicap not being good enough or not existing as the reason.

However some courses do check so I wouldn't rely on this being the case. Spain has lots of courses, especially in popular tourist areas, so why not just play courses that don't need a handicap certificate?

I've played a number of courses in southern Spain (Costa del Sol) and only one of the courses I played required proof of handicap. So long as you follow etiquette and keep up pace of play you should have no problems at the majority of Spanish golf courses.

Possible exceptions would be the famous courses, Valderama etc. i'd suggest just calling a couple of courses in advance of your trip to check whether it is okay. Spanish golf is generally laid back and great fun!
